18:39.49S 173:58.94W Port of Refuge, Neiafu, Vava'u, Kingdom of Tonga
Thursday 12th June PM


We arrived in Tonga early on Monday and found a mooring off Neiafu.

We did the usual diving trips on Tuesday in some sea caves and reef
drop-offs. The coral here is amazing with fans and soft corals of all
shapes, sizes and colours.

There have been a few Tongan feasts to get through since arriving, always
with some unfortunate piglets getting turned into table decorations. There
are a lot of piglets happily running around the streets here that seem to
have no idea what's in store.

Tonight's extravaganza will be a kava ceremony at the 'Bounty Bar' which
apparently involves getting anesthetised drinking something like dishwater
out of a big bowl. I'll let you know how it goes. If I can.
